Output 514d94375faa640a5cee811fe359f2e617a7149f9bdffa38ed2620920d8cc262: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80248e8d09ef5deca85d6914ce6d9c717195979b OP_EQUAL
address
3DNaD7SKSKcLGwrdYvMkV4TTiu1miAtq2H
transaction
514d94375faa640a5cee811fe359f2e617a7149f9bdffa38ed2620920d8cc262
confirmations
328218
spent
true